    Default Re: C4d exporting of tiffs with alpha

    I get the same error as Soquili in XaraX1, If I delete the alpha channel in PS, it loads into Xara no transparency, If in PS I use the alpha as a selection, copy the object and paste it onto a new layer, then select all and clear the background layer, save the image as PNG, then it imports into Xara with transparency.

    Default Re: C4d exporting of tiffs with alpha

    Don't use C4D myself, so maybe this comment is worthless.

    But, I do bring alpha transp. from Carrara into Xara (X1 and Xtreme) as a tiff. all the time.

    I render the image out as a psd. format with alpha map enabled. I then open the image in Corel Photo Paint just long enough to export it out again as a tiff.

    Opens as intended in Xara with transp. background.

    Default Re: C4d exporting of tiffs with alpha

    Hi Liam,

    Thanks for your input. I wonder if CorelDraw version 4 would work with tiffs with alpha transparency? It's a very old version that my brother had among his software collection, which I inherited.

    I'll see if a tiff with alpha from Photoshop will import into Xtreme.

    Edit: OK, the PS tiff with alpha imports without a problem into Xtreme. I've tryed over and over again to get a tiff with alpha created from C4D to import and it will not. I opened the C4D export into PS and the alpha doesn't show up in the layers or the properties. I can convert it to tiff with alpha in PS and re-export and Xtreme imports it without any complaints. It may be a problem with C4D version 8.5, anyone have version 9 or higher they can test my theory?
